Ohio University hosted a men and women’s basketball doubleheader on Saturday with mixed results and a lot of excitement. The Ohio men fell 101-98 to Central Michigan in double overtime, while the women welcomed Ball State, boasting the second-best record in the Mid-American Conference, and defeated the Cardinals 80-76.
After looking at the men’s squad that was dealt two big blows at the beginning of the year and their subsequent struggles, it’s important to note that the Ohio women had arguably bigger obstacles to overcome.
This season has seen the men fall to a 9-13 overall record with a 2-8 showing in the MAC, good for last place in the conference’s East Division.
